好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

《组合可编程逻辑器》课件.pptx

27页
  • 卖家[上传人]:亦***
  • 文档编号:533615796
  • 上传时间:2024-06-10
  • 文档格式:PPTX
  • 文档大小:2.72MB
  • / 27 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 组合可编程逻辑器PPT课件目录CONTENTS组合可编程逻辑器简介组合可编程逻辑器的基本结构和工作原理组合可编程逻辑器的编程语言和开发环境目录CONTENTS组合可编程逻辑器的实际应用案例组合可编程逻辑器的未来发展趋势和挑战结论01组合可编程逻辑器简介组合可编程逻辑器是一种数字逻辑电路,可以通过编程实现特定的逻辑功能定义具有高度的灵活性、可重配置性和可扩展性,可以根据需要进行重新编程和配置,广泛应用于数字系统的设计和实现特点定义与特点组合可编程逻辑器的概念起源于20世纪70年代,当时主要是基于晶体管和集成电路的硬件描述语言(如VHDL和Verilog)进行设计和实现早期阶段随着技术的发展,出现了基于查找表(LUT)的FPGA(现场可编程门阵列)和CPLD(复杂可编程逻辑器件)等更先进的组合可编程逻辑器发展阶段目前,基于高级综合(HLS)和神经网络的组合可编程逻辑器正成为研究热点,可以实现更复杂和高效的数字系统当前阶段组合可编程逻辑器的发展历程用于实现通信协议、信号处理、调制解调等功能通信领域用于实现计算机硬件、操作系统、编译器等底层系统计算机领域用于实现工业控制、智能家居等领域的控制逻辑。

      控制领域用于实现音频、视频、图像等信号的处理和传输数字信号处理领域组合可编程逻辑器的应用领域02组合可编程逻辑器的基本结构和工作原理用于接收外部信号或数据,并将其传递给可编程逻辑器输入接口这是可编程逻辑器的核心部分,用于实现用户定义的逻辑功能逻辑编程单元将逻辑编程单元处理后的信号或数据输出到外部设备或系统输出接口负责协调和调度整个可编程逻辑器的操作,确保其正常工作控制单元基本结构工作原理控制单元根据HDL代码,配置逻辑编程单元中的可编程逻辑门(如AND、OR、XOR等)以实现所需的逻辑功能将用户定义的逻辑功能编译成可执行的硬件描述语言(HDL)代码用户通过编程语言(如VHDL或Verilog)定义所需的逻辑功能输入接口接收外部信号或数据,并将它们传递给逻辑编程单元进行处理逻辑编程单元处理后的信号或数据通过输出接口输出到外部设备或系统不同类型的输入信号或数据需要使用不同的输入接口,以确保正确地接收和传递给可编程逻辑器输出接口的类型和数量取决于可编程逻辑器的规格和设计要求,常见的输出接口包括推挽输出、开漏输出和三态输出等输入/输出接口输出接口输入接口03组合可编程逻辑器的编程语言和开发环境VHDL:用于描述数字电路和系统的行为和结构。

      SystemVerilog:用于描述数字系统和验证方法Verilog:用于描述数字电路和系统的行为和结构Python:用于算法和逻辑设计常见的编程语言Xilinx的集成开发环境,用于FPGA设计ISEXilinx的集成开发环境,用于SoC设计VivadoAltera的集成开发环境,用于FPGA设计ModelSimAltera的集成开发环境,用于FPGA设计Quartus开发环境的选择与使用模块化设计将复杂的逻辑设计划分为多个简单的模块,便于管理和维护时序约束确保设计的时序满足实际应用的需求资源共享合理利用FPGA资源,避免浪费代码优化提高代码的效率和可读性编程技巧与注意事项04组合可编程逻辑器的实际应用案例数字信号处理简介数字信号处理是一种使用数学算法对信号进行变换、分析和提取特征的技术组合可编程逻辑器在数字信号处理中的应用组合可编程逻辑器因其高速并行处理能力和灵活性,被广泛应用于数字信号处理领域,如滤波器设计、频谱分析、图像处理等案例分析介绍几个基于组合可编程逻辑器的数字信号处理应用案例,如音频信号降噪、雷达信号处理等数字信号处理中的应用03案例分析介绍几个基于组合可编程逻辑器的通信系统应用案例,如4G/5G移动通信、卫星通信等。

      01通信系统简介通信系统是实现信息传输和交换的设施总和,包括有线通信、无线通信、卫星通信等02组合可编程逻辑器在通信系统中的应用组合可编程逻辑器在通信系统中主要用于信号调制、解调、编解码等处理过程,提高了通信系统的性能和可靠性通信系统中的应用组合可编程逻辑器在控制系统中的应用组合可编程逻辑器在控制系统中主要用于实现高速、实时的控制算法,如PID控制、模糊控制等案例分析介绍几个基于组合可编程逻辑器的控制系统应用案例,如工业自动化控制、航空航天控制等控制系统简介控制系统是实现自动控制的关键组成部分,通过比较设定值和实际值来调整系统的输出控制系统的应用05组合可编程逻辑器的未来发展趋势和挑战随着计算需求的不断增加,硬件加速器在组合可编程逻辑器中的应用将更加广泛,以提高处理速度和效率硬件加速器为了简化编程和提高开发效率,新型编程语言和工具将不断涌现,使得开发者能够更加便捷地利用组合可编程逻辑器进行开发新型编程语言利用人工智能和机器学习技术,实现组合可编程逻辑器的智能化设计,提高设计效率和准确性智能化设计技术创新与进步物联网随着物联网技术的发展,组合可编程逻辑器将在传感器数据处理、边缘计算等领域发挥重要作用。

      自动驾驶自动驾驶汽车需要大量的计算和数据处理能力,组合可编程逻辑器能够提供高效、可靠的计算解决方案云计算在云计算领域,组合可编程逻辑器可以应用于虚拟化、网络加速和存储优化等方面,提高云计算服务的性能和效率应用领域的拓展技术标准不统一由于组合可编程逻辑器技术发展迅速,目前缺乏统一的技术标准,导致不同厂商之间的产品互操作性差解决方案是通过行业协会或标准化组织推动技术标准的制定和推广可靠性和稳定性问题组合可编程逻辑器在应用过程中可能面临可靠性和稳定性问题,如硬件故障、软件缺陷等解决方案是通过加强测试和验证,提高产品的可靠性和稳定性人才培养和生态系统建设组合可编程逻辑器技术的快速发展需要大量的专业人才和完善的生态系统支持解决方案是通过高校、培训机构和企业合作,加强人才培养和生态系统建设面临的挑战与解决方案06结论组合可编程逻辑器是一种灵活且功能强大的数字逻辑设计工具,它允许设计者通过编程语言实现各种逻辑功能该技术为数字电路设计带来了极大的便利,尤其在复杂系统设计中具有显著优势总结组合可编程逻辑器在数字逻辑设计中具有很高的应用价值,它极大地提高了设计的效率和灵活性然而,它也存在一些挑战,如编程语言的学习曲线、硬件资源的限制以及设计验证的复杂性等。

      评价组合可编程逻辑器的总结与评价研究进一步研究组合可编程逻辑器的性能优化和算法改进,以提高其处理大规模数字电路的能力同时,探索与其他数字设计方法的结合,以实现更高效的设计流程应用推广组合可编程逻辑器在更多领域的应用,如嵌入式系统、通信和网络、人工智能等此外,加强与产业界的合作,推动该技术在产品开发中的实际应用对未来研究和应用的建议THANKS感谢您的观看。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.